        @Lenny-O Not that I know of.

        MRA does have an "avoid unpaved roads" option but that isn't the same thing as visualizing the unpaved section. For example, the unpaved section may only be 100 meters long and would be perfectly rideable but MRA will completely avoid it, many times taking you on a much longer and much less desirable route.

                  The way OSM displays the layers depends on the stylesheet used when rendering the tiles.
                  Different tiles servers that use OSM render there tiles with a different stylesheet.

                  Depending on the stylesheet the tiles are rendered different.
                  for example the OSM standard map and the opencyclemap use the same data but look different.
